The Kensington Hilton is a slight misnomer as it is closer to Holland Park. It is easy to find, just off the motorway. The underground car park is not owned by Hilton, but you can get a discount coupon from reception if you are resident. The exterior and lobby are very impressive, with green coated doormen and at least two people manning the concierge desk at all times.
